Luigi Bruno is an Associate Professor of Machine Design at the Department of Mechanical, Energy and Management Engineering (DIMEG), University of Calabria. He has held this position since 2014, following 12 years as an Assistant Professor at the same institution and Visiting Professorships at IIT Gandhinagar (2012), University of Alabama at Birmingham (2013-2017), and Free University of Bozen-Bolzano (2021).
- 1999: Master's in Mechanical Engineering, University of Calabria (110/110 cum laude)
- 2003: PhD in Mechanical Engineering, University of Pisa
His research interests span:
- Experimental Mechanics: Pioneering speckle interferometry for micro-displacement measurement and residual stress analysis.
- Materials Science: Elastic characterization of anisotropic materials, biomedical applications of soft substrates, and 3D-printed composites.
- Biomedical Engineering: Mechanical behavior of biological tissues, ocular biomechanics, and dental implant material testing.
Recent research trends focus on:
- Integrating artificial muscles into rehabilitation devices
- Advancing full-field optical measurement via microCT/DVC
- Optimizing 3D printed polymer adhesion for industrial components
- Exploring neuronal biomechanics on soft surfaces
Scientific contributions include:
- CS2007A00010 patent for dual-focus speckle interferometers
- Deputy Editor of Optics and Lasers in Engineering (2019-present)
- Guest Editor for special issues on optical methods in experimental mechanics and nanobiotechnology
Academic leadership extends to coordinating Mechanical Engineering committees (2021-present), serving on editorial boards, and organizing international conferences like AIAS National Conference (2018). He has secured multiple MIUR research grants and industry collaborations with Alfagomma, 3DNA, and Ferrovie della Calabria.
His laboratory, Mechanics of Materials and Structures, supports both research and teaching activities with advanced optical measurement systems and computational tools for mechanical design.
